The Intelligence Program Manager, assigned to a specific client, will serve as a liaison between Pinkerton and the client by developing and maintaining strong relationships and effectively addressing client needs and concerns. This role contributes to high-consequence strategic and geopolitical foresight, provides guidance to the mid-level Intelligence Analyst's workflow for internal alignment, and ensures full adherence to GTI writing standards through editorial review. Additionally, the Manager oversees the timely response to intelligence requests, conducts in-depth analysis of all-source analysis, and produces clear and concise intelligence products.

Responsibilities

  • Represent Pinkerton’s core values of integrity, vigilance, and excellence.
  • Serve as the client liaison and manage ongoing client relationships.
  • Ensure all services are conducted in a timely and professional manner and aligned with Pinkerton’s Service Delivery Standards.
  • Assist the Pinkerton Director with ongoing client service needs.
  • Address client questions and/or concerns quickly and effectively.
  • Manage account performance, P&L, KPIs, and regularly review evolving client needs and industry trends to improve future results.
  • Conduct Quarterly Business Reviews with the client and other Pinkerton management.
  • Contribute to high-consequence strategic and geopolitical foresight.
  • Lead and manage the workflow of the Intelligence Analyst II's to ensure internal alignment.
  • Perform the first-pass editorial review for the Analyst’s work to ensure 100% adherence to GTI writing standards.
  • Manage vendor staffing, continuity, and performance reporting.
  • Respond in a timely manner to requests for intelligence information.
  • Review and verify information, intelligence reports, alert notices, crime prevention surveys and disseminate data to appropriate client staff members.
  • Research, evaluate, integrate, and analyze all-source data in the preparation and presentation of clear, concise, and in-depth intelligence analytical products.
  • Monitor, detect, analyze, and advise the client on regional adverse conditions including civil unrest, crime, environmental hazards, and weather conditions.
  • Develop expertise to discern trends and warnings and provide an accurate understanding of present and future threats.
  • Assess and maintain a variety of situational awareness tools to advise decision makers quickly and accurately on possible courses of action.
  • Review and utilize diagnostic tools and technology sources to develop complex data compilations.
  • Identify gaps in current analysis products and develop new solutions, methodologies, and products to help improve reporting, especially in data-driven analysis.
